R.C. Orlan leading UNC in wins as relief pitcher
Posted May 31, 2012
Left-handed relief pitchers are often cast into the same role by baseball coaches, entering a game to retire a left-handed batter, then exiting so the next pitcher can resume work. That's how R.C. Orlan spent his first two years at North Carolina, but as a junior, the Deep Run graduate is breaking the mold, going deeper in games and proving indispensable in one of college baseball's best bullpens.
